AI 搜尋 API 比較整理
以下從兩個角度整理目前常見的 AI 搜尋 API 與相關方案:
- 主流方案的能力、優缺點與適用情境。
- 免費額度與是否需要綁定信用卡。
主流 AI 搜尋與 Google 方案綜合比較
| 工具分類 | 工具名稱 | 核心優勢 | 主要缺點 | 輸出格式 | 適用情境 |
|---|---|---|---|---|---|
| AI 原生(專為 Agent 設計) | Tavily | 專為 RAG 優化,會自動清理網頁內容並去重,能減少 Token 浪費。 | 價格相對較高;搜尋深度有時受限於其爬取邏輯。 | 純文字 / Markdown | RAG 應用、自動化研究員、AI Agent |
| AI 原生(專為 Agent 設計) | Exa (Metaphor) | 速度快,採用神經網路搜尋,能找到語義相關但關鍵字不同的內容。 | 搜尋結果有時與傳統關鍵字預期不同。 | 乾淨的網頁 Context | 尋找相似網頁、高併發快速回應應用 |
| AI 原生(擷取與轉換) | Firecrawl | 強大的網頁爬取與轉換能力,能將整站內容轉成 Markdown。 | 主要是爬蟲而非搜尋引擎,通常需要先提供網址。 | 結構化 Markdown | 深入挖掘特定網站、LLM 資料集準備 |
| Google 體系(官方整合) | Gemini Grounding | 官方直接整合,在 Gemini API 內開啟即可,無須額外串接搜尋流程。 | 綁定 Gemini 模型,無法靈活切換其他 LLM。 | 生成式文字(附來源連結) | 使用 Gemini 作為核心模型的應用 |
| Google 體系(官方 API) | Google CSE API | 索引完整,資料涵蓋面廣且更新快。 | 雜訊較多,回傳通常是標題、網址、摘要,若要全文仍需自行抓取。 | JSON(標題、網址、摘要) | 傳統網頁搜尋、只需要連結不需要全文 |
| Google 體系(第三方封裝) | Serper.dev | 可視為 Google 搜尋 API 的輕量替代,速度快且成本相對低。 | 仍需搭配 Jina Reader 或其他爬蟲工具才能取得完整內文。 | 乾淨的 JSON | 需要高品質 Google 結果但預算有限 |
| Google 體系(第三方封裝) | SerpApi | 功能最完整,可抓取地圖、圖片、新聞、購物等多種 Google 結果。 | 價格較高;並非專為 LLM Context 最佳化。 | 完整結構化資料 | 需要處理特殊搜尋結果,如地圖或購物 |
免費額度與綁卡門檻比較
這一段偏向實際導入前的門檻比較,適合用來快速篩掉不符合預算或註冊條件的方案。
| 服務名稱 | 核心優勢 | 免費額度 | 是否需綁卡 | 適合場景 |
|---|---|---|---|---|
| Tavily | AI 專用,自動過濾雜訊,對 LLM 友善。 | 1,000 次 / 月 | 不需要 | 打造 AI Agent、RAG 檢索、網頁內容抓取 |
| Serper.dev | 穩定的 Google 搜尋替代方案。 | 2,500 次(總額) | 不需要 | 需要精準 Google 搜尋結果、地圖或新聞資訊 |
| Exa (Metaphor) | 語義搜尋,按內容意義找網頁。 | 1,000 次 / 月 | 不需要 | 深度研究、尋找相似網頁、取得乾淨內容 |
| DuckDuckGo | 完全免費,常見於開源工具與 Python 套件整合。 | 無明確限制 | 不需要 | 輕量測試、不想註冊帳號或 API Key |
| Brave Search | 有自有索引,隱私性較高。 | 約 $5 額度 | 必須綁卡 | 正式環境部署、高品質資訊摘要 |
快速決策指南
- 要省事且效果好,首選 Tavily。它能同時處理搜尋、讀取網頁內容與基礎整理。
- 對速度與語義搜尋能力有要求,優先考慮 Exa。
- 需要 Google 的結果品質,又希望後續拿到全文內容,可用 Serper.dev 搭配 Jina Reader 或 Firecrawl。
- 只需要把聯網查詢能力接到 Gemini 應用裡,Gemini Grounding 是最省整合成本的做法。
- 若重點是免費試用且不想綁卡,Tavily、Serper.dev、Exa、DuckDuckGo 都比 Brave Search 更容易起步。
補充說明
- Firecrawl 偏向內容擷取與網站轉換,不建議單獨視為通用搜尋引擎。
- Google CSE API 與 Serper.dev 都偏向提供搜尋結果,不等於直接提供乾淨可餵給 LLM 的全文內容。
- 免費額度、價格與綁卡政策可能隨官方方案調整,正式導入前仍應再查一次最新方案。